Cat Lake Airport Key Codes and Location Details

Cat Lake Airport Key Codes and Location Details

Cat Lake Airport (YAC/CYAC) is located at 51°N 91°W in Canada. It serves as a vital aviation hub for the Cat Lake First Nation community. The airport provides essential transportation links for residents and visitors, facilitating access to goods, services, and other communities. Its presence is crucial for connectivity in this remote region of Canada.

Guide to Key Codes for Crossborder Ecommerce Sellers

Guide to Key Codes for Crossborder Ecommerce Sellers

This article provides a detailed explanation of three common documents in cross-border e-commerce: C88, C79, and E2. It clarifies their individual meanings, purposes, and relationships. C88 is a customs tax notification, E2 is the proof of tax payment, and C79 is a monthly statement of import and export goods, which can be used to deduct VAT. Understanding these key points can effectively avoid tax risks for cross-border businesses.

Ebay Sellers Guide Optimizing Listings with UPC Codes

Ebay Sellers Guide Optimizing Listings with UPC Codes

This article details how to obtain and use UPC codes on eBay. It provides methods such as purchasing, official application, UPC generators, and borrowing Amazon UPC codes. It emphasizes that each SKU must correspond to a unique UPC code, which cannot be changed after uploading. This guide helps sellers avoid common pitfalls during product listing and ensures smooth e-commerce operations on the eBay platform.
